直接用距离公式,这个不想说什么了。
代码如下:
#include <stdio.h>
#include <math.h>
int main()
{
int i;
int te;
double a[6];
double sum;
scanf("%d", &te);
while(te--)
{
for(i = 0; i < 6; i++)
{
scanf("%lf", &a[i]);
}
sum = 0;
sum += sqrt((a[0] - a[2]) * (a[0] - a[2]) + (a[1] - a[3]) * (a[1] - a[3]));
sum += sqrt((a[4] - a[2]) * (a[4] - a[2]) + (a[5] - a[3]) * (a[5] - a[3]));
sum += sqrt((a[0] - a[4]) * (a[0] - a[4]) + (a[1] - a[5]) * (a[1] - a[5]));
printf("%.5lf\n", sum);
}
}